Los Angeles to Richmond Coach Timetable

Coach from Los Angeles to Richmond: Journey Information

There are 2 intercity coaches per day from Los Angeles to Richmond. Traveling by coach from Los Angeles to Richmond usually takes around 8 hours and 30 minutes, but the fastest FlixBus US coach can make the trip in 8 hours and 15 minutes.

Los Angeles

Los Angeles is the undisputed world capital of the entertainment business. Because of that, the City of Angels is where you will find some of the most iconic landmarks of the film and music industries, including the world-famous Walk of Fame and Dolby Theatre (home of the Academy Awards) on Hollywood Boulevard, the easily recognizable Capitol Records building at Hollywood & Vine, and the LA Live complex in Downtown Los Angeles.

The best part of LA is that it has something to offer for people of all interests: outdoor enthusiasts can hike up to the Hollywood sign, fashion aficionados can go shopping in Beverly Hills, art lovers can check out the prominent Los Angeles County Museum of Art (LACMA) in the Miracle Mile district, and those looking for a fun night out can go bar-hopping in West Hollywood. Are you a Pokémon GO addict? Well then this is the place for you because LA is the best city to catch the rarest Pokémon in the U.S.. And if you want to want to experience the famed golden coast of Southern California for yourself, head west to Santa Monica and Venice for a refreshing dip in the Pacific Ocean.

With one of the biggest airports on the West Coast and several bus and train stops across the county, Los Angeles makes it easy to travel elsewhere in California, visit the neighboring Nevada, Arizona and Mexico, or take a flight to pretty much any other part of the world.

Richmond

Richmond is a city in the South Francisco Bay Area, popular for its rich naval history, specifically its role in the World War 2 home front. During this time, thousands of workers moved to the city to support wartime industries. Richmond features different waterfront neighborhoods and houses facing the river with miles of waterfront areas. Richmond offers its residents scenic parks, shorelines, and outdoor spaces, including Tilden Regional Park, Point Pinole Regional Shoreline, and Regional Parks Botanic Garden. The city also has some unique places to check out, like the Miller/Knox Regional Shoreline, which combines a park with a rail museum, and the Redwood Valley Railway.

In Richmond, there are exciting things to do, like zipline adventures in Sonoma and Brazen Racing. The city boasts a fast-growing craft beer scene, with popular names like Fieldwork Brewing and East Brother Beer Company. You can time your visit to participate in the Richmond Main Street Initiative, beer and food, and art festivals. For shopping and restaurants, check out Downtown Richmond.

Richmond is easily accessible from 137 other cities by train, with most trains provided by Amtrak Capitol Corridor. If you prefer to travel by bus, you can follow the routes provided by FlixBus US US from tens of other cities. Within Richmond, there are dedicated public transit routes through BART and Amtrak.
